    Oldskool Uk plan Amibench replacement

    For those that are mourning the loss of Amibench after ten years, us at Oldskool UK are looking to create an alternative site to replace it, Tecno wants to keep the Amibench name, so it's looking like ours will be called Amibay. We just want to offer an alternative to Fleabay specifically for the Amiga scene, in the way Amibench did.

    We could do with some web coders on board to set the site up, we are looking at hosting options at present.

    If you would like to help, please pop over to Oldskool UK and let us know.

    As you probably know, classicamiga is running on its own dedicated server, so I can offer to help with the hosting of such a project if needed, as long as it's not something that is going to really hit the server hard. In addition I can offer classicamiga sub domains.

    I did used to run a For Sale/Wanted section on the original version of the classicamiga website, and it was quite popular with people sending in adverts weekly. And on the current site there is a section in the members area for buying and selling items, but it has only ever been used by one member of the site, so has remained unused. For this reason I was actually considering removing it from the site.

    I've been considering an Amiga auction section on the classicamiga forum for some time and there are already pre-made auction mods that exist, which could make life much easier. But it would be interesting to see what ideas for such a site have been posted on Oldskool UK.
